What is Clickteam Fusion AI?
Clickteam Fusion is a 2D game development engine that uses a visual event-based programming system to create games without traditional coding. The AI aspect refers to AI-powered features including pathfinding, behavior trees, and intelligent game object behaviors built into the engine. Clickteam Fusion has been used to create commercial games including The Escapists, Five Nights at Freddy's, and several other indie hits. It is designed for developers who want to create 2D games with a visual programming approach rather than writing code.
Key Features
- Visual Event System: Event-based programming where game logic is created through conditions and actions in a visual interface, no code required.
- AI Pathfinding: Built-in pathfinding algorithms for enemy AI, NPC movement, and character navigation around obstacles.
- Physics Engine: Integrated physics simulation with gravity, collision detection, and object physics for realistic movement.
- Animation Editor: Sprite animation system with frame-by-frame editing, bone animation, and automatic animation generation.
- Cross-Platform Export: Export games to Windows, Mac, iOS, Android, Xbox, and HTML5 from a single project.
- Effect System: Built-in visual effects including shaders, particles, lighting, and screen effects for game polish.
- Extension System: Hundreds of community extensions adding functionality including multiplayer, achievements, and in-app purchases.

Pricing
Clickteam Fusion offers a free version with limited features and a watermark. The Developer version costs approximately $129 for a lifetime license including all features, no watermark, and commercial use. The Team version at $349 adds collaboration features. Pros & Cons
Pros: Visual event system is powerful and intuitive. Proven track record with commercial game releases. Cross-platform export covers major platforms. Large community with extensive extensions and resources.
Cons: Visual programming can become unwieldy for complex projects. Limited to 2D games only. The interface has a steep learning curve despite being visual. Performance is not as good as hand-coded engines for demanding games.
